§ 57-21-210 — Advertisement and award of contracts.

The governing body of the county shall advertise for bids for at least thirty days in one or more newspapers published in the county in which the paving district is located for all work to be done and the material to be used in constructing, grading, treating and paving any streets or roadways in the paving district and for equipment to be used in connection therewith, with the right reserved to reject any and all bids, and shall enter into contracts with the lowest responsible bidder therefor and secure competent persons, if deemed advisable, to superintend the work and to counsel and advise in all matters relating thereto.

Legislative History

HISTORY: 1962 Code SECTION 33-1371; 1952 Code SECTION 33-1371; 1942 (42) 1693.
